About
Rifugio Malga Malera sits at 1,561m in the Dolomites foothills of Veneto, on the Altopiano dei Sette Comuni plateau. The hut is accessible from multiple trailheads. The nearest road access is from Asiago; most hikers approach via marked trails from the valley below, typically 2–3 hours depending on your starting point. The surrounding terrain is rolling Alpine meadow—expect easier walks rather than technical climbing.
The rifugio is a working mountain dairy as well as a hut, which means you'll find genuine local cheese and dairy products on the menu. It has capacity for around 50 guests in mixed and private rooms. Meals feature Veneto mountain cooking: polenta, game, local cheeses, and hearty vegetable soups. The hut operates year-round, though winter availability depends on snow and weather—confirm before planning a winter visit. Basic facilities include hot showers and a small bar.
Contact the hut directly by phone or email to book, especially for summer weekends and July–August when the plateau attracts significant foot traffic. Book at least 4–6 weeks ahead for peak season. Half-board (dinner, bed, breakfast) is standard. The hut is not affiliated with CAI, so book independently rather than through rifugio.net. The working dairy schedule sometimes affects meal times, so clarify meal service when you call.
